#fluss_start{
    width:950px;
    min-height:800px;          
    height:auto !important;  /* für moderne Browser */                                                     
    height:800px;  /*für den IE */
}

#startseite_kopfbild {
    width:220px;
    height:136px;
    float:right;
    background-image:url(../images/startseite_kopfbild.jpg);
}

#startseite_kopftext {
    width:195px;    
    font-size:18px;
    color:#005697;
    margin-left:110px;
    float:left;
    display:inline;
}

#inhalt-rahmen_startseite{
    float:left;
    width:auto;
}

#startseite contentbereich {
    width:950px;
    position:relative;
    background-image:url(../images/teaser_bg.gif);
    background-position:right;
    background-repeat:repeat-y;
    text-align:left;
}

#startseite_rahmen{
    width:auto;    
    margin-left:35px;
    border-top:solid 1px #000000;
    float:left;
    display:inline;
}


#startseite_box{
    float:left;
    display:inline;
    width:689px;
    margin:52px 0 0 5px;
}


#startseite_box ul, #startseite_angebote ul{
    padding-left:3px;
    padding-top:10px;
    list-style-type:none;
}

#startseite_box ul li, #startseite_angebote ul li{
    background-image:url(../images/bluedash.gif); 
    background-repeat:no-repeat; 
    background-position: 2px 5px;
    padding-left:17px;
}


#startseite_box a.link_1, #startseite_box a.link_1:hover {
    background-image:url(../images/navi_level2_background.gif);
    display:block;
    line-height:28px;
    color:#000000;
    font-weight:bold;
    font-size:13px;
    text-align:center;
    border-top:solid 1px #CCC;
    text-decoration:none;
    margin:15px 0 5px;
}

.startseite_table {
    width:652px;
    border:0;
}

td.startbreit {
    width:193px;
    vertical-align:top;
}

td.startbreit li a{
    color:#000000;
}


td.spacer {
    width:36px;
}

#clearbox{
    clear:left;
}

.startlinks a, .startlinks a:hover, .startlinks ul{
    color:#000000;
    text-decoration:none;
}

/*
#startseite_bg{
    float:left;
    background-image:url(../images/startseite_bg.jpg);
    height:230px;
    width:344px;
}
*/

#teaser-start{
    width:221px;
    height: 100%;
    float:right;
    line-height: 20px;
    font-size:12px;
    border-top: 1px solid #1a171b;
}

*+html teaser-start {
    padding-right:220px;
    margin-right:220px;
}

#startseite_angebote{
    line-height:17px;
}

.angebote {
    height:216px;
}

#startseite_angebote a, #startseite_angebote a:hover, #startseite_box1 .navigation_1 a, #startseite_box1 .navigation_2 a{
    font-family:Arial;
    font-size:13px;
    color:#1a171b;
}

#startseite_angebote ul{
    padding-left:5px;
}

#startseite_news{
    margin-top:60px;
    padding-left:20px;
    color:#7e8080;
    font-weight:bold;
}

#newsstoerer b{
color:#005697;
}

#newsstoerer {
    position:absolute;
    top:445px;
    left: 499px;
    width: 438px;
    font-family:Arial;
    font-size:13px;
    font-weight:normal;
    z-index:99;
    line-height:17px;
}

.news_ueberschrift {
    padding:10px;
    color: #FFFFFF;
    font-family:Arial;
    font-size:13px;
    font-weight:bold;
    z-index:99;
}

.news_ueberschrift_bg {
    background-color:#005697;
}

.news_bg {
    background-color:#FFFFFF;
}

#startseite_navigation_rechts{
    margin:700px 0 0 70px;
}
